## Configuration

The Quillgate CSV import wizard reads all settings from the service env file; nothing is hardcoded. Reviewers should verify `IMPORT_MAX_ROWS`, `IMPORT_STRICT_SCHEMA`, and the upload bucket region before approval. The wizard refuses to start without an encryption secret, which the env file must define on the line immediately following the bucket region.

vault entry, yahif-yajep: COURIER_KEY29=b802bdf8034096b65a51c6ba5abe2

- [ ] **Step 7: Breaker override escrow.** After sealing the signing keys for the Tallgrove upstream API circuit breaker, confirm the support team can force the breaker open during a full outage. The override bundle lives in the sealed escrow drawer and is useless without its unlock phrase. Two ceremony witnesses must initial this step before proceeding. The escrow bundle is decrypted with the recovery passphrase that follows.

vault phrase of kahip-kahop = holath-quenmir

## Deployment

The `tailhawk` CLI streams logs from the Quillbrook aggregation tier and is deployed alongside each worker pool. Build it from the `release` branch only; builds from feature branches lack the signed transport module and will be rejected by the gateway. After installing the binary, place the configuration file in the standard path before the first run, and verify the checksum against the release manifest. The daemon reads its settings once at startup, so restart after any change. The required configuration values are listed below.

service settings:
PRAIX_LOG_LEVEL=error
PRAIX_METRICS_HOST=metrics.praix.qorvelcorp.corp
PRAIX_POOL_SIZE=16

## Deployment: Replica Lag Alarm

Before approving this change, note that Quillgate's read replicas now emit a lag metric every ten seconds, and the alarm fires when lag exceeds the threshold for three consecutive intervals. The alarm routes to the on-call rotation for the Harborline team, not the database owners, so page noise should be reviewed carefully. The rollback path is a single config revert. The values currently deployed to production are as follows.

settings of yageg-yahap:
[gorael]
team = olieth
access_code = ac_941d74
owner = brieth.aldiel
host = gorael.tolvaqio.internal
port = 6379
peer = briwyn.urlaqtech.internal
salt = 116e6622
pin = 1957